What is Bank of Marin Bancorp's noninterest expense directors fees?
Bank of Marin Bancorp (BMRC) reported noninterest expense directors fees of $285K in Q1 2026.
How has Bank of Marin Bancorp's noninterest expense directors fees changed year-over-year?
Bank of Marin Bancorp's noninterest expense directors fees decreased by 11.5% year-over-year, from $322K to $285K.
What is the long-term trend for Bank of Marin Bancorp's noninterest expense directors fees?
Over 4 years (2021 to 2025), Bank of Marin Bancorp's noninterest expense directors fees has grown at a 5.4% compound annual growth rate (CAGR), from $957K to $1.18M.
What does noninterest expense directors fees mean?
Includes compensation paid to members of the board of directors for their oversight and governance services. This is a standard corporate governance expense necessary for maintaining board leadership.
